Ai+ PulseTab Launched in India as Brand’s First Tablet

Ai+ has entered the tablet market in India. The company launched its first tablet, the Ai+ PulseTab, on Thursday. It unveiled the new device alongside the Ai+ Nova 2 5G series and the Ai+ Nova Flip 5G smartphone.

The Ai+ PulseTab features a large 10.95-inch display. It comes with a MediaTek Helio G88 chipset and 128GB of internal storage. The tablet also includes quad speakers, an 8,000mAh battery, and a 13-megapixel rear camera. Customers can choose from two colour options.

Pricing and Availability

The Ai+ PulseTab is priced at Rs. 9,999 for the 6GB RAM + 128GB storage variant. This is the only configuration available. The tablet will go on sale in May via Flipkart and selected retail stores across the country.

Key Specifications and Features

The PulseTab runs on Android 16. It offers a 10.95-inch Full HD display with a resolution of 1,200 x 1,920 pixels and a smooth 90Hz refresh rate. The screen delivers up to 400 nits of peak brightness.

Under the hood, the tablet is powered by an octa-core MediaTek Helio G88 chipset. It comes with 6GB of RAM and 128GB of storage. Users can expand the storage further up to 1TB using a microSD card.

For photography, the Ai+ PulseTab includes a 13-megapixel rear camera with autofocus. It also has an 8-megapixel front camera for selfies and video calls.

The device packs an 8,000mAh battery that supports fast charging. It offers Wi-Fi and 4G LTE connectivity. Additionally, quad speakers deliver clear audio experience.

The Ai+ PulseTab is the first tablet from the Ai+ brand, which is owned by NxtQuantum Shift Technologies. The company, led by Madhav Sheth, has recently launched several new devices including the Ai+ Nova 2 5G series and the Ai+ Nova Flip 5G clamshell foldable smartphone.

With its affordable price and decent specifications, the Ai+ PulseTab aims to attract students, casual users, and families looking for an entry-level Android tablet in India.
